Georg
Hübner, born 1962 in Vienna, Austria
I turned to photography in 1993 after years as musician. As I was tremendously impressed by the power of expression of high-quality fine arts prints, my first years in this field were filled with learning the basics about photography followed by my need for excelling in the negative and positive technique introduced by Ansel Adams. A few years later after several trips to various segments of the photographic landscape (like infrared-shots, landscape and spontaneous snapshot photography) I developed my individual style which was and still is mainly influenced by the works of Czech photographers Michal Macku and Jan Saudek. Long before a picture comes alive and is realised, I have the idea and the image of it in my head. All my experience, my feelings and dreams are the material from which slowly but surely shapes as well as light & shade impacts are formed which I then further develop into the real thing whith the help of models and self-developed manipulation techniques. My demands on the finished prints lies with the authentic description and production of fleeing moments of joy or fear which are known to every human being.
